About
Cutthroat Trout Campground is a small, no-fee BLM-managed site located along the scenic Blackfoot River east of Blackfoot, Idaho. This semi-developed campground offers 3 campsites available on a first-come, first-served basis with no reservation system in place. The campground is equipped with vault toilets, picnic tables, fire rings, a horseshoe pit, and a developed put-in/take-out point for river floaters.
The Blackfoot River provides excellent opportunities for fishing, particularly for trout species, and non-motorized boating. The river is a popular destination for kayakers and rafters looking to experience Class II and III rapids along the 23-mile stretch. Anglers should be aware of Idaho fishing regulations, which include special limits on cutthroat trout harvest in this area.
As a pack-in, pack-out facility, there are no dumpsters on site, so visitors must bring all trash with them when they leave. Campground rules and regulations are posted at the site. The location offers a peaceful riverside camping experience with basic amenities for those seeking a quiet retreat along one of southeastern Idaho's premier river corridors.
